Self-help ✦ Penny’s Take
Love Colors
Pamala Oslie · 2007
48/100
👎 Skip It
The entire framework here is aura-color psychic reading presented as factual — this is not a metaphor layer on top of relationship psychology, it is the premise. For readers already inside New Age spirituality, the interactive self-tests and warm tone make for an engaging system. For anyone else, non-falsifiable advice on partner compatibility based on unverifiable aura criteria is a real problem, not a quirk.
